Etymology / Origin

  • Jakub is the Czech and Slovak form of the biblical name Jacob, derived from the Hebrew Ya‘aqov, meaning “heel‑holder” or “supplanter.”
  • Klíma is a Czech surname that may originate from the Czech word klíma, meaning “climate” or “weather.” As a surname, it could historically denote a family associated with a particular region’s climate or could be an occupational or descriptive name.
